pea and mint soup recipe
This refreshing soup is a great appetizer and starter for parties and get-togethers.
Basic ingredients for pea and mint soup recipe
- 2 cups green peas,
- 1/2 cup mint leaves
- 2 Tbsp butter
- 1 Tbsp chopped garlic
- 1 small onion chopped
- 2-3 fresh Thyme sprigs
- Salt for taste
- 4 cups vegetable broth + to adjust consistency Fresh cream to garnish
How to make pea and mint soup recipe
- In a nonstick skillet, heat butter and let it melt. Sauté 1 tablespoon chopped garlic in a non-stick wok until it turns golden brown.
- Chop 1 small onion and cook until translucent. Mix in 2-3 fresh thyme leaves, green peas, and salt.
- Now Bring 4 cups of vegetable stock to a boil. Cook the peas on low heat until softened and cooked. The thyme sprigs should be thrown out.
- After this, remove this mixture from the heat and add the mint leaves. Let the mixture cool down slightly. Blend the mixture until it is a smooth paste in a blender.
- Place the puree in the same saucepan and return it to the heat. To adjust the consistency, add the stock.
- Mix in the black pepper powder. Bring the soup to a boil.
